Default 2007 ULTRA QUESTION (STAGE 1)

Prior to taking my bike in for the 1K I installeda K&N and plan on installing V&H slip-ons in the near futher. While at the dealer he advived doing theStage 1 download, which I did have done. When Iasked if I had to return when I install thepipesI was toldno that I was good to go.I like tokeep the dealer honest and ask if this sounds right or any recommendations anyone my have.. Default RE: 2007 ULTRA QUESTION (STAGE 1)

I understood that the stage 1 download was not applicable for 07s (the 96" motor). If you add air filter and pipes you are best to remap your ECM. I used the SERT and am very happy with the results.

Default RE: 2007 ULTRA QUESTION (STAGE 1)

With the slip-ons you should be OK. If you had put the slip-ons on and not done the Stage 1, you usually don't have to remap. But when you change the intake of air with the Stage 1 you are changing a lot more. If you were to change the whole exhaust system you would need to go back for a download again. IfI'm understanding you correctly you should be OK. I have my Pythonslip-ons on my '07 without a Stage 1 and haven't done the downloadand have no problems.

Default RE: 2007 ULTRA QUESTION (STAGE 1)

How do you/the dealerknow the download was correct for a K&N filter and V&H slipons?? Did they dyno it?? What if you would have used a V&H Big Sucker AC and Rinehart slipons ? Would the same D/L have been correct ? It was my bleif that the "canned" downloads were only good for bikes with SE air cleaners and SE pipes. And even then you will only be close. Bike needs SERT or V&H Fuel Pac or PC. Then dyno'd
